STERLING – Robert Leo Flickinger, 88, died May 31, 2015, at Elm Grove Estates, Hutchinson. He was born June 9, 1926, in rural Reno County, the son of Joseph W. and Alma Stuckey Flickinger. He graduated from Sterling High School with the class of 1944. A longtime resident of rural Sterling, he was a retired farmer.

 He attended United Methodist Church, was a member of American Legion, and Men’s and Couples Bowling League, all of Sterling. He was a U.S. Army veteran, serving during World War II in the Philippines.

On July 24, 1949, he married Mary Ella Fulkerson in Sterling. She survives. Other survivors include two sons, Norman Scott Flickinger and Bradley Wayne and Rhonda Flickinger, both of Sterling; daughter, Janice Louise and David Duran, North Bend, Wash.; 10 grandchildren; and 22 great-gr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his parents; daughter, Catherine Flickinger; son, James Flickinger; and brother, Clyde Flickinger.
